You will need to think of the following things first:

> Height
> Weight
> Riding Ability
> Disipline or Use (Hacking, SJ, XC, Dressage or general etc)
> Your horse or shared with friends/family
> Type of horse you enjoy (slow & lazy, calm & willing, fizzy & hyper etc)
> Sex - Mare / Gelding /Stallion
> Age


Once you have figured that out a type / size of horse should come to mind.

IE:

> Height -5'8''
> Weight - 9 Stone
> Riding Ability - Novice
> Disipline or Use - Everything
> Your horse or shared with friends/family - Odd rides from friends
> Type of horse you enjoy - Calm and willing to work
> Sex - Gelding
> Age - Mature

If your situation was like this then I would suggest a 15 - 16.2HH, 10 year old gelding. Easy to handle, mess around on, not spooky or silly and is happy to do whatever is asked of him.
